Shanna Underwood Means is singer Carrie Underwood's sister who rarely appears publicly. The singer's sister usually decides to be seen on special and meaningful occasions.

Advertisement

Although Carrie Underwood has achieved immense success in the entertainment industry, she loves celebrating her family's achievements, particularly those of her sister, Shanna Underwood Means.

Shanna Underwood Means is one of the singer's beloved older sisters. She may not be in the same glamorous world as the "Jesus Take the Wheel" hitmaker, but she has found success and fulfillment in a noble profession.

Shanna Once Joined a Protest Concerning School Funding

Advertisement

Carrie Underwood's sister is a dedicated teacher in Oklahoma. Shanna inherited her passion for teaching from their mother, Carole Underwood, a former teacher with an impressive 25-year career in education. The renowned musician said:

"Teaching was something that ran in my family. I have always admired my mother and sisters for making a difference in the lives of so many."

Like Shanna, another sister in the family shares the same profession — Stephanie Underwood. Shanna and her sister received immense support from the famous singer, especially during the 2009 Teachers Count campaign.

Shanna deeply loves her job as a teacher. She and Stephanie took part in a protest to secure better funding for schools, and her famous sibling expressed immense pride for their unwavering commitment to improving education.

Shanna as a Teenager Enjoyed Styling Her Younger Sister

Shanna is the oldest sister, followed by Stephanie, and then the former "American Idol" star. They all grew up in the quaint town of Checotah, Oklahoma. Shanna's parents still reside in their childhood home.

Carrie practically became the only child at home when her older sisters embarked on their paths. She admitted that feeling the "only-child syndrome" due to her and her sisters' wide age gap led to some traits of independence and selfishness.

Subsequently, she and Carole grew closer, nurturing a strong mother-daughter relationship. While she and her sisters drifted apart, the trio had beautiful memories together in their early years.

When she was a teenager, Shanna loved helping her little sister look her best, especially with fashion. Shanna's youngest sister viewed her and Stephanie as the epitome of coolness with their voluminous '80s hairstyles.

As children, Shanna and her other sister would dress up their younger sister and put makeup on her. The renowned musician fondly remembered being their "human Barbie doll," which sparked her love for makeup.

Shanna Underwood Means Lives a Private Life

While her younger sister enjoys the limelight, Shanna prefers a more private life. However, from time to time, she does make appearances on her famous sister's social media account.

In July 2023, Shanna, her sisters, and their mom celebrated their deep bond by getting matching heart tattoos in Las Vegas. It was their mother who wanted all of them to have similar tattoos.

Carrie had her heart tattoo on her right foot, while Shanna, Stephanie, and Carole had similar images inked on their wrists. The music superstar was surprised at the idea of their mom getting a tattoo, saying she never expected to see the day it would happen. For their tattoos, the ladies went to artist Darek Riley.
